The circuit in figure consists of two identical parallel metal plates connected by
identical metal springs to a 100 V battery.
The surface area of one plate is 1778 m². With the switch open, the plates are
uncharged, and separated by a distance
d = 10 mm. When the switch is closed, the distance between the plates decreases
by a factor of half. What is the spring constant, in Newton/meter, for each spring?
E, = 9 x 10-12 C² /Nm²
a) 160000 b) 20000 c) 10240 d) 2500 e) 1280
